Who won the Snellville Mayoral and City Council elections?

Jerry Oberholtzer has won re-election as Mayor of Snellville. It was a very close race - Mayor Jerry Oberholtzer had 1,101 votes and Bruce Garraway had 1,082.

For Snellville City Council Post 1, Kelly Kautz was the victor, with 1,230 votes. Marilyn Swinney had a decent showing with 951 votes.

Of note: Loganville voters approved the liquor by the drink referendum. LINK
"I feel that the public has spoken about what they want," said city councilman Chuck Bagley, who has helped to rally support for the referendum. "They really saw it as an economic issue, not an alcohol issue.".....

..... "Neal Byrd, a realtor, said he was relieved that the grassroots fight against it didn't work this time. He stood on a corner rallying votes for the "economic development tool" early Tuesday morning.

Already, there is talk of new restaurants moving to Loganville now that the referendum has passed, said Byrd."
